WM&D carries out R&D and provides operational plant support services covering processing of operational and historic wastes, management of liquid and aerial effluents, waste immobilisation of LLW and higher activity wastes (cementation, vitrification), decommissioning, management of radioactive contaminated land and both surface and geological disposal.

Waste management services are also available for the processing of wastes, including by thermal treatment and chemical processing to remove contamination.

The capability has an operational presence in NNL’s active facilities at Sellafield and Preston and in NNL Workington rig hall. We are organised into the three capability areas as shown below. Waste Packing & Disposal

Waste Packing and Disposal capability provides expertise in:

  • Waste and disposal strategy development
  • ILW waste product development and long-term performance
  • Environmental assessment, land quality management and site restoration
  • Site characterisation and plant support
  • Regulatory permissioning and compliance assessment
